The Jackson 5 Era: A Family’s Harmony

Before the global phenomenon, before the moonwalk, there was Gary, Indiana. Michael’s journey began with the Jackson 5, a family act that quickly captured the hearts of America and, eventually, the world. The young Michael, with his incredible talent, became the lead singer, his voice a clear and vibrant instrument from the start. His youthful voice, characterized by its purity and unique timbre, became the defining sound of the group, catapulting them to unprecedented success. The Jackson 5’s music was deeply rooted in the soul and gospel traditions of the time, heavily influenced by the sounds of Motown, a soundscape that shaped the young artist. These formative years provided the foundation for his future vocal evolution.

Stylistic Choices and Production Techniques

Beyond natural changes, he was a master of stylistic choice. He would often choose how to shape his voice to add depth and intensity to his songs. Some songs were more soulful while some were more breathy and delicate. In each case, the effect was a carefully-crafted sound designed to augment the emotional impact of the songs.

Recording techniques also significantly impacted his vocal presentation. During the studio sessions, music producers used a variety of techniques, including multi-tracking and vocal effects. These effects added depth and nuance to his voice, enhancing its overall impact. He also experimented with vocal layering, creating rich harmonies and backing vocals that gave his songs a unique character.

A Journey Through Sound: The Evolution Across Eras

Let’s delve into the different phases of his illustrious career and compare the vocal characteristics that defined each one. *Off the Wall* was the start of his solo career, and his voice was still young and free, showing raw talent and range. *Thriller* shows a more mature voice and control; his vocals had become more expressive, and the album has songs that became global anthems. In the period of *Bad*, his vocals demonstrate more sharpness. During the *Dangerous* period, the voice became more versatile and capable, and the melodies demonstrate a willingness to embrace complex rhythms and sounds. *HIStory: Past, Present and Future, Book I*, highlights his capacity to take on more complex themes and arrangements, including heavier sounds with more passion.
